Brian and Linda: A Lifetime of Laughter!

 


Tickets are now on sale for an afternoon with comedy legends Brian Murphy and Linda Regan at the Museum of Comedy. The event will take place on Sunday 20 March at the Museum in Central London.

Sam Westerby will host the event, with an interview followed by an opportunity to meet the stars at the end of the show. The show will kick off at 2pm.

Brian Murphy has enjoyed a long and successful career with memorable starring roles in television sitcoms Man About The House and George and Mildred (both with the late, great Yootha Joyce). More recently Brian appeared for seven years in the comedy series Last of the Summer Wine. Other credits include The Avengers, Callan, Dixon of Dock Green and Z Cars. He is also, of course, married to Linda.

Linda Regan is probably best known for playing April in the classic 1980s sitcom Hi-de-Hi! Other television appearances have included Minder, London's Burning, The Bill and Birds of a Feather. On the big screen, Linda appeared in one of the later Carry Ons, Carry On England in 1976. Other films have included On The Buses, Adolf Hitler: My Part in his Downfall (with Jim Dale), Confessions of a Pop Performer and Adventures of a Private Eye. More recently Linda has become a successful author specialising in crime fiction.
